Output e4d4e844c23574ee793083e27a15210d87fba937ec235f037f29579b89dff1d5:0

value
9788756143
script pubkey
OP_0 OP_PUSHBYTES_20 67c966f5aa003d276448e9e9e5ac7e0efc3ed1d5
address
tb1qvlykdad2qq7jwezga857ttr7pm7ra5w40wvx8u
transaction
e4d4e844c23574ee793083e27a15210d87fba937ec235f037f29579b89dff1d5